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ost in Green Valley, AZ

The cost of tree root pipe damage water removal in Green Valley, AZ can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water extracted
Root removal and pipe rep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of pipes and complexity of repair
Documenting damage for insurance $0 – $500 Complexity of damage and amount of documentation required
Final inspection and cleanup $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and amount of cleanup required
Emergency service call $100 – $500 Time of day and urgency of situation
More repairs or replacements $500 – $5,000 Size and complexity of repair or replacement

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and free estimates are available.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an and budget.
